How Business Can Sow Climate Optimism and Drive Action
Briefly

The climate crisis has transitioned from a distant threat to an immediate reality, affecting millions daily. As the world surpassed 1.5°C of warming, urgency grows for action. A recent IKEA survey shows 68% of customers view climate change as the primary threat, yet only 6% can afford to pay more for sustainable products. Business leaders must recognize the importance of addressing these concerns as failure to act may lead to customer disengagement. Embracing sustainability is not only ethically responsible but can also enhance economic performance by reducing waste and driving profitability over time.
